How does North Adams Regional Hospital Corporation compare?

On price, North Adams Regional Hospital Corporation's average procedure payment of $22,555 runs $6,677 above the national average of $15,878. Against Massachusetts's state average of $21,636, this hospital is right around the state norm.

On quality, the 0-star CMS rating combines mortality, patient safety, readmissions, and patient experience. North Adams Regional Hospital Corporation's 0-star CMS rating is below the national median, which most often reflects elevated readmissions or worse-than-expected outcomes in specific care categories.
